09:23 <Debutant_Python> Bonjour à toutes et tous :)
09:24 <Debutant_Python> Quelque'un peut m'orienter pour envoyer des emaisl avec python
09:24 <Debutant_Python> ?
09:24 <Debutant_Python> J'ai fait des recherches et en tapant les scripts de base j'ai des messages d'erreurs !
09:31 <gawel> Debutant_Python: il suffit de corriger les erreurs
09:35 <Debutant_Python> merci gawel , mais je ne sais justement pas comment les corriger ! Je ne comprends pas à quoi elle correspondent
09:38 <Debutant_Python> L'envoi d'un email en python necessite-t-il un parametrage des librairies ? du genre smtplib.py ?
09:41 <gawel> il faut un serveur smtp
09:41 <gawel> et l'utiliser
09:51 <Debutant_Python> gawel, j'utilise python sur ubuntu, j'ai donc un serveur email car je m'en sers pour mes sites internet
09:53 <gawel> en effet
10:01 <Debutant_Python> .
10:05 <mpeeters> Debutant_Python: sudo python -m smtpd -n -c DebuggingServer localhost:25 pour avoir un smtp de debug
10:06 <mpeeters> et http://pypi.python.org/pypi/mailer si tu veux un package python pour envoyer des mails
10:08 <Debutant_Python> merci mpeeters
10:08 <Debutant_Python> je vais jeter un oeil a ca !
10:20 <Debutant_Python> mpeeters: Tu sais comment utiliser directement python 3.1 en tapant python dans l'invite de commande ?
10:21 <Debutant_Python> j'ai deja installé python 3.1
10:21 <mpeeters> tu es sous ubuntu donc ?
10:22 <mpeeters> Debutant_Python: /usr/bin/python3.1 ?
10:22 <Debutant_Python> oui
10:22 <Debutant_Python> c'est ca
10:22 <Debutant_Python> a l'invite quand je tape python ,; c'est la version 2.5 qui se lance
10:23 <Debutant_Python> ou quand je tape python -V j'ai python 2.5.6
10:24 <mpeeters> par défaut dans /usr/bin y'a le lien symbolique 'python' qui pointe vers le python installé de base avec le système
10:24 <Debutant_Python> ok,je dois donc le modifier
10:25 <mpeeters> soit ca, soit tu créer un alias dans ton bashrc
10:26 <mpeeters> exemple : alias python='/usr/bin/python2.5'
10:26 <Debutant_Python> ou j'accede au bashrc ?
10:26 <Debutant_Python> ah ok, je comprends !
10:26 <mpeeters> il se trouve dans ~/.bashrc
10:27 <Debutant_Python> si je saisi directement la commange alias ... ca doit fonctionner directement
10:27 <Debutant_Python> non ?
10:28 <mpeeters> oui
10:28 <mpeeters> mais ca ne sera pas persistant
10:28 <Debutant_Python> ok, donc je tape : alias python="usr/bin/python3.1
10:28 <gawel> Debutant_Python: python3.1 est un peu daubé. il faudrait installer python3.3
10:28 <Debutant_Python> ah ok
10:28 <Debutant_Python> ca marche si je fais apt-get install python3.3 ?
10:29 <gawel> ca dépends de ta ditrib. c'est possible
10:30 <Debutant_Python> zut il le trouve pas !
10:30 <Debutant_Python> va falloir faire en manuel :(
10:31 <gawel> tu peux utiliser python3.1, hein, mais bon, c'est un peu la première release de python3, comme toutes les première release, c'est pas trop ça
10:31 <gawel> mais ça reste utilisable
10:32 <Debutant_Python> ;)
10:32 <gawel> cela dit la plupart des librairies sont porté à python3.2+. perso je zappe python3.1
10:32 <gawel> mpeeters: comme tout le monde, sauf les débutants :D
10:32 <Debutant_Python> je pensais qu'en faisant : apt-get install python3 j'aurai l'installation de la 3.3
10:33 <mpeeters> gawel: j'ai déja un peu jouer avec python3 mais en prod on est limité à python2.7
10:33 <gawel> ca dépends de la distrib. je crois que 3.1 est dans la ubuntu "stable" et va faire chier pendant 4ans
10:35 <Debutant_Python> j'a recemment lu qu'il etait préférable de debuter avec python 3.3 que 2.7 !! d'apres ce que vous dites ce n'est pas impératif
10:35 <Debutant_Python> je souhaite développer des scripts d'envoi d'emails,
10:36 <Debutant_Python> vous pensez que je peux rencontrer des limitations ?
10:37 <mpeeters> Debutant_Python: si j'avais le choix, je passerais à python3, mais en utilisant zope / plone tu es forcé de rester en 2.7 voir 2.6 ou 2.4
10:38 <Debutant_Python> c'est pour faire des sites web zope ?
10:38 <mpeeters> oui
10:38 <Debutant_Python> ok
10:38 <Debutant_Python> comme django
10:38 <Debutant_Python> sur le principe ?
10:39 <mpeeters> sur l'idée de faire des sites web oui, pour tout le reste non :)
10:39 <Debutant_Python> a quel reste fais tu reférence ?
10:39 <Debutant_Python> :)
10:40 <mpeeters> La manière dont c'est codé
10:40 <Debutant_Python> ok
10:40 <Debutant_Python> c'est lequel le mieux ?
10:40 <Debutant_Python> d'apres toi ?
10:41 <mpeeters> pour moi c'est zope, mais c'est avant tout une question de goût
10:42 <Debutant_Python> ok!
10:43 <Debutant_Python> je fais quoi moi alors ?
10:43 <Debutant_Python> j'utilise 2.7 ou 3.3 ?
10:43 <Debutant_Python> :)
10:44 <mpeeters> ca dépend de tes objectifs :)
10:45 <Debutant_Python> mon objectif a court terme : réaliser uun script de mass mailing !!!!
10:45 <Debutant_Python> on verra apres ):
10:46 <Debutant_Python> mais je ne sais pas pourquoi ca m'interesse python
10:46 <Debutant_Python> plus que les autres langages !
10:47 <mpeeters> pour ton objectif à court terme tu aura peut être plus de facilité à le faire en python2.x
10:48 <mpeeters> puisqu'il existe une très grande quantité de code pour python2.x dont seulement une petite partie est compatible avec python3.x
10:50 <gawel> y a quand même plein de trucs, maintenant :)
10:51 <Debutant_Python> ah ok :!
10:52 <Debutant_Python> en attendant faut que j'arrive a résoudre mes messages d'erreur pour un envoi d'email simple en python 2.5
10:52 <Debutant_Python> et ca c'est pas gagné
10:52 <Debutant_Python> y'a aucune aide sur le net avec ca !:
10:52 <Debutant_Python> c'est abbérant
10:53 <mpeeters> gawel: oui ca bouge, mais je trouve que c'est encore trop limité
10:54 <Debutant_Python> vous utiliser python pour le fun ou le taf ?
10:54 <mpeeters> pour le boulot
10:55 <Debutant_Python> ok
10:55 <Debutant_Python> pour des sites internet ?
10:55 <Debutant_Python> tu me stoppes si je ta gave avec mes questions :)
10:55 <mpeeters> oui
10:56 <Debutant_Python> mince tu réponds a quelle question la ? ;)
10:57 <mpeeters> la première :)
10:58 <Debutant_Python> ;)
19:04 <yota> gawel: ping